Understanding DRSABCD in First Aid
What Does DRSABCD Stand For?
- D - Threat: Ensure the setting is risk-free for you and the victim. R - Reaction: Look for responsiveness; tremble the person gently and ask if they are okay. S - Send out for Aid: If less competent, call emergency situation services immediately. A - Respiratory tract: Ensure the respiratory tract is clear by tilting the head back and raising the chin. B - Breathing: Check for regular breathing; look, listen, and feel for breath. C - CPR: If there's no breathing, start CPR (Cardiopulmonary Resuscitation). D - Defibrillation: Make Use Of an AED (Automated External Defibrillator) if available.
Understanding DRSABCD is basic to effective first aid. Each part plays an essential duty in analyzing a situation and establishing the necessary actions.
How to Use DRSABCD?
In practice, applying DRSABCD includes a series of actions that a person should comply with systematically:
Assessing Risk: Always prioritize your safety and security prior to coming close to a victim. Checking Reaction: Gently tremble or heckle the individual to check their alertness. Calling for Assistance: In situations where prompt medical aid is required, contact emergency situation services without delay. Clearing Air passage: Usage methods like jaw thrust or chin lift if needed. Checking Breathing: Observe upper body motions or pay attention for breath sounds. Performing CPR: If less competent and not breathing normally, start CPR right away-- 30 compressions complied with by two rescue breaths. Using AED: If defibrillation devices is available, follow its guidelines promptly.These sequential actions enable you to supply systematic support while awaiting professional help.

What Is CPR?
Cardiopulmonary Resuscitation (CPR) is an essential lifesaving strategy utilized in emergency situations when a person's heart beat or breathing has stopped.

When Should You Do CPR?
CPR should be carrara emergency response courses carried out promptly if:
- A person is less competent There are no indicators of breathing An experienced collapse occurs
Steps to Do CPR
Call emergency situation solutions immediately prior to starting CPR. Place your hands on the center of the individual's chest. Push down set a minimum of 2 inches deep at a rate of 100-- 120 compressions per minute. After every 30 compressions, give 2 rescue breaths if trained.Knowing just how to perform CPR can dramatically enhance survival prices after abrupt cardiac events.
First Help Methods for Common Injuries
Choking Incidents
Choking occurs when an item blocks air flow right into the lungs. Recognizing signs such as inability to speak or cough can lead you to act quickly.
Steps to Aid Choking Victims
Ask them if they're choking; if of course:- Encourage them to cough if able. Administer back blows adhered to by stomach drives (Heimlich maneuver).
Cuts and Scrapes
Minor cuts call for basic cleansing and bandaging while severe cuts might need professional medical attention.
How to Treat Cuts?
Rinse under tidy water. Apply antibiotic lotion if available. Cover with clean and sterile bandage.Burns Treatment
Burns vary from small scalds to extreme injuries requiring immediate care based upon severity.
Treating Minor Burns:
Cool under running water for 20 minutes. Cover with sterilized clothing without sticking straight onto shed area.Mental Health First Aid
